Yum China Holdings, Inc. has unveiled a new look for Pizza Hut as part of the revitalization plan, marking a new chapter for the restaurant chain.
The refreshed brand identity, centered around the theme 'Always Something New,' incorporates a redesigned logo, modern store design and exclusive new uniforms designed by fashion designer Anna Sui, according to a press release.
The company has also launched a Pizza Hut Pioneer store in Nanjing that will test and refine dishes with customers before they are extended to Pizza Hut stores within the national network of over 2,200 stores.
"Connecting to a younger generation of consumers and ensuring the brand stays fresh and relevant are fundamental to our revitalization strategy," Yum China CEO Joey Wat said in the release. "Our refreshed brand identity marks a new chapter for Pizza Hut in China, reflecting our commitment to bringing customers innovative experiences and dishes. Our upgraded stores, new logo and uniforms all contribute to a more modern, fashionable dining experience while our exciting Pioneer concept store is designed to take customers on a journey of new tastes and discovery."
The new autumn/winter store uniforms, inspired by Sui's retro rock 'n roll style, have been adopted across all stores in China.
The new Pizza Hut restaurant features an open kitchen, dining room, bar, indoor garden and family dens in spaces designed to feel like a chef's home. The stores also feature table-side ordering via mobile phones.
The Pioneer store menu will initially feature unique, never-before-seen dishes, such as Pizza Hut's square Italian pizzas and "dirty" dessert series. Pizza Hut intends to open more Pioneer stores in different parts of China to gain deeper insight into customers' ever evolving preferences.
Additionally, the brand is opening a new, smaller-store format in Nanjing with dine-in seating options as well as the capacity to cater to the growing demand for home delivery and designed to offer the full Pizza Hut menu. Delivery is expected to account for a significant portion of sales at the store which has a separate delivery room to facilitate a fast and efficient delivery process. The new store format is expected to be well matched to customer preferences in lower tier cities.
